Schneider Electric Acti9 iC60H Series Miniature Circuit Breaker, 32A Current, 10kA Breaking Capacity - A9F53332
This miniature circuit-breaker provides overcurrent protection for three-phase and DC installations, combining a thermal-magnetic trip unit with instantaneous response for fault clearing. It is designed for DIN-rail, clip-on mounting within industrial control panels and distribution boards, offering a Compact form suited to constrained enclosures.
Features & Benefits
• 32A rated current for steady conductor protection
• Type B tripping gives fast response to low fault currents
• 10 kA breaking capacity for 440V AC fault interruption
• Thermal-magnetic mechanism for overload and short-circuit clearance
• Screw terminals accept up to 35mm² conductors for secure connections
• IP20 degree of protection for indoor panel environments

Applications
• Suitable for motor control circuits requiring Rapid trip action
• Ideal for branch circuit protection in automation panels
• Used with DC supply sections within control systems
• Can be used for distribution boards in electronics workshops
• Suitable for protective segregation in mechanical plant control

What mounting and installation features help speed panel assembly?
The device clips onto standard DIN rail and occupies six 9mm module pitches, allowing compact, repeatable layout and straightforward rail-mounted wiring.
How does the unit indicate a tripped pole for Rapid fault diagnosis?
A contact position indicator and a local trip marker provide visible status signalling at the device face without removing covers.
What environmental limits define safe operation ranges?
It operates between -35 to 70 °C ambient and tolerates up to 95% relative humidity at 55 °C for use in demanding industrial atmospheres.
What electrical endurance can be expected under normal switching?
The breaker is specified for 10,000 electrical cycles and 20,000 mechanical cycles, supporting frequent switching in automated systems.
What connection requirements are specified for reliable conductor termination?
Wire stripping length is 14mm and tightening torque for TOP or bottom terminals is 3.5 N·m to achieve proper clamping of rigid and flexible conductors.
